Chargesheets served in AIIMS question paper leak case
Chennai, Mar 20 (UNI) A Special Court trying CBI cases today served copies of the chargesheet to 52 persons including 45 doctors in the case relating to leakage of question and answer papers during the All India Institute of Medical Sciences (AIIMS) PG medical entrance examination on January 8, 2006.
Special Judge N Velu trying CBI cases, furnished copies of the chargesheet to Dr T T Pradeep, Dr Duraimurugan, Dr P Jeyakumar and 49 others when they appeared before him.
The judge posted further hearing of the case to April 10.
According to the CBI, during the PG medical entrance examination, question and answer papers were leaked by adopting methods like sending answers through SMS. In Tamil Nadu, 4,188 candidates appeared for the examination. Fifty two persons including 45 doctors were cited as accused in the chargesheet.
Some were arrested and released on bail. Some accused turned approvers.
